minionsExpected to top the weekend box office is the animated feature Minions directed by Pierre Coffin &  Kyle Balda and featuring the voices of Sandra Bullock, Jon Hamm, Michael Keaton, Allison Janney, Steve Coogan and Geoffrey Rush. The film’s original music is composed by Heitor Pereira (Despicable MeThe SmurfsIf I StayBeverly Hills Chihuahua). Back Lot Music has released a soundtrack album featuring the composer’s score, as well as the songs from the movie by artists including including The Turtles, The Kinks, The Who, Donovan and The Spencer Davis Group. giacchino-oscarsMichael Giacchino has been elected to the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ences’ 2015–16 Board of Governors. He joins Charles Bernstein and Charles Fox who are the other two governors of the branch. It will mark Giacchino’s first term serving on the music branch board. The Academy’s 17 branches are each represented by three governors, who may serve up to three consecutive three-year terms. 12-monkeysVarese Sarabande has announced the details of the first soundtrack album for the Syfy original series 12 Monkeys. The album features selections from the first season of the show’s original music composed by Trevor Rabin (Remember the TitansNational TreasureCon AirArmageddon) and Paul Linford. The soundtrack will be released on July 31, 2015 and is now available for pre-order on Amazon12 Monkeys is based on Terry Gilliam’s 1995 movie of the same title and stars Aaron Standford, Amanda Schull, Noah Bean and Kirk Acevedo. The drama centers on a time traveler from the future who appears in present day on a mission to locate and eradicate the source of a deadly plague that will eventually decimate the human race. selflessVarese Sarabande has announced the details of the soundtrack album for the sci-fi thriller Self/Less. The album features the film’s original music composed by Antonio Pinto (City of God, Lord of War, McFarland, USA, The Host, Snitch) and Dudu Aram. The soundtrack will be released on July 24, 2015. Self/Less is directed by Tarsem Singh and stars Ryan Reynolds, Natalie Martinez, Matthew Goode, Victor Garber, Derek Luke, Michelle Dockery and Ben Kingsley. The movie follows a wealthy man dying from cancer who undergoes a radical medical procedure that transfers his consciousness into the body of a healthy young man and starts to uncover the mystery of the body’s origin and the organization that will kill to protect its cause. matthew-margesonMatthew Margeson is set to score the upcoming biographical drama Eddie the Eagle. The film is directed by Dexter Fletcher (Sunshine on Leith, Wild Bill) and stars Taron Egerton, Hugh Jackman, Christopher Walken, Jo Hartley, Tim McInnerny and Ania Sowinski. The movie tells the story of ski jumper Michael Edwards who rose to fame as the very-last-place finisher in two events at the 1988 Winter Olympics in Calgary, but left as a scene-stealing poster boy for never-say-die underdogs everywhere.
